Don't know if this is the correct section to ask this question but my gearbox or clutch (don't know to be honest) is giving me problems, from cold in the morning when starting its difficult to put into 1st sometimes I have to touch the accelerator to help it go into gear. The clutch doesn't slip and it pulls away as normal also the gears don't crunch so I don't think it's the synchromesh. There is 120000 miles on the clock ( car is an English import) and the clutch hasn't been changed since new, I'm guessing that it might need a new clutch but it works fine, a bit of a head melt, any ideas, cheers.

If it is struggling to go into gear and you are having to rev the car to get it in it does sound to me like a clutch issue, I wouldn't have thought it was a synchromesh problem.

 

When it wont go into 1st have you tried selecting another one of the gears first ? - do they go in ok? Have you tried going into 2nd or 3rd (with clutch pedal down) and then tried selecting 1st?
